"Hey there is a game we want to play a lot and we don't have the time for it"
^that is literally the closest thing the ER has to a "point",
@hedfone said:You're right but they've always seen that game, reviewed that game, and in Jeff's case at least, played that game multiple times. It would be kind of ridiculous to do an Endurance Run of that. They did an ER of Persona 4 because they were curious about it but didn't have much time for it on their own and thought it might be interesting. They did Deadly Premonition because it was quirky and had grassroots buzz and they, again, wouldn't play it otherwise. Those same reasons don't exist for Deus Ex so it would be kind of crazy for them to do that.I don't think you do either.
